Literature summary extracted from

  • Chanchaem, W.; Palittapongarnpim, P.
    The significance and effect of tandem repeats within the Mycobacterium tuberculosis leuA gene on alpha-isopropylmalate synthase (2008), FEMS Microbiol. Lett., 286, 166-170.
    View publication on PubMed

Cloned(Commentary)

EC Number Cloned (Comment) Organism
2.3.3.13 H37Rv leuA gene with and without the tandem repeats is cloned by PCR and expressed in an Escherichia coli host. The 57-bp tandem repeats located in the leuA gene code for the alpha-isopropylmalate synthase. Deletion of the repeats has no detectable effect on leuA expression level or the general properties of the enzyme product Mycobacterium tuberculosis
